Integr8 Fuels: Are bunkers too easy a target when problems alleged onboard vessels?

Problem fuels do exist and can result in difficulties, but without adequate precautions even an on specification VLSFO has the potential to cause damage, it advises.

Integr8 Fuels, the bunker trading and brokerage arm of Navig8, on Wednesday (22 July) published an article outlining other often overlooked factors that could damage components onboard vessels apart from bunkers; it was written by Chris Turner, Global Manager for Quality and Claims:

Prior to IMO 2020 there was a lot of conjecture mingled with a fair spattering of trepidation as to the perceived level of quality issues we would see with many stakeholders suggesting significant problems were on the horizon using analogies of our old foe 1% Sulphur LSFO and the relatively recent Houston problem among others.

Overview

As it happened and as widely reported many of these gloomy predictions did not come to pass, Q1 2020 passed with all stakeholders relatively unscathed despite the new world of a patchwork quilt of VLSFO qualities. Things have changed more recently however with ARA being thrust into the spotlight as a result of high TSPs and an increase in the prevalence of Estonian Shale Oil in VLSFO blends.

Circumstances of high TSP of course allow the buyer to lodge a claim against the seller given the value exceeds a maximum contractual guarantee however what has become apparent is an increasing frequency of fuels that appear on specification to Table 2 parameters of ISO 8217 yet have been alleged to have caused fuel management related issues as well as equipment component damage.

Curiously still,many of these fuels when examined forensically have been found not to contain any sinister contaminants and do not correlate with a “problem” fuel according to testing experts.

Food for thought

It would of course be remiss of us to not acknowledge that problem fuels do exist and can result in difficulties or damage onboard vessels, however it is important to make the point that without adequate precautions even an on specification VLSFO has the potential to cause damage.

This is nothing new, indeed HSFO routinely contained 30 to 60mg/kg of Aluminium and Silicon (cat fines). Even these levels of abrasive catfines would have to be removed to below 15mg/kg by purification and of course if this was not efficient or effective then harmful particles could reach the engine resulting in catastrophic damage to cylinder liners etc.

Indeed whilst catfines are generally lower in VLSFOs almost a quarter of all VLSFOs however in Singapore for example still have catfines of greater than 40mg/kg and still require extensive purification.

This should not be too difficult a task given the lower density and viscosity of VLSFOs when comparing to HSFO but it is vital to remember that purifiers still need to be set up correctly considering the pour point of the fuel as well as its density and viscosity.

It is also entirely possible that the reason for a chocked purifier may be as a result of mixing with previous ROB, not in the storage tank – as this is hardly ever noted these days – but in the settling tank itself.

VLSFO’s also require to be injected at the correct viscosity, generally speaking most OEMs require a viscosity of 12cSt at the engine inlet. Indeed it may be that in extreme cases of low viscosity that this may not be possible to achieve without a cooler being employed or without being in close proximity of the pour point if it is waxy.

Finally, an increasingly new and important area of focus is engine lubrication and an increase in engine wear which may result should this not be optimized to the new fuels.

Prior to IMO 2020 It was well publicized that as an Industry we would have to move to a lower Base Number (BN) Cylinder Lubrication Oils (CLOs) given prolonged running on 0.5% Sulphur fuels however what appears to have developed is a pattern of vessels suffering major engine damage since switching to VLSFO despite also all switching to BN 40 CLOs and all fuels meeting the ISO 8217 specification.

Evidence has been published of red tinged piston tops and abrasion as a result of calcium deposits which have not been removed due to the reduced detergency of BN 40 CLO’s.

Indeed you could argue that some of these issues were foreseen as early as March 2018 when MAN indeed recommended the introduction of Cermet (Chromium) coated piston rings at next overhaul given their experiences with ULSFOs. MAN have also issued a number of service letters in recent months describing the benefits including providing a “seizure resistant surface against the liner.. avoiding micro seizures and lowering scuffing risks”

Conclusion

Therefore all things considered, whilst it is absolutely prudent to put the fuel supplier on notice of alleged damage at the earliest opportunity so as to avoid the robust time bar clauses in the bunker contract we must not lose sight of the fact that these issues may well be as a result of other factors rather than the fuel itself.

It is therefore important to go into every investigation with an open mind, work on fact and not assumption, collate and document evidence which would survive robust cross examination and more importantly do so in a transparent manner.

Yang Ming orders six LNG dual-fuel, ammonia-ready containerships from Hanwha Ocean

Taiwanese shipping firm Yang Ming Marine Transport Corporation (Yang Ming) and South Korean shipbuilder Hanwha Ocean on Wednesday (2 September) signed a shipbuilding contract for six 13,000 TEU class LNG dual-fuel container vessels. 

The contract was signed by Dr. Chuck Tsai, Chairman of Yang Ming, and Mr. Charles Kim, CEO of Hanwha Ocean. The vessels are scheduled for delivery between 2028 and 2029. 

They will complement Yang Ming’s existing fleet of 10,000+ TEU vessels and serve as key vessels on East-West services, with deployment flexibility across trade lanes connecting Asia with the East and West Coasts of North America, South America, and the Mediterranean. 

Each of the six new vessels will have a capacity of up to 13,650 TEU and feature LNG dual-fuel propulsion and Ammonia Fuel Ready specifications.

“As Yang Ming transitions toward net-zero emissions, LNG provides a relatively mature and economically viable alternative fuel solution, capable of reducing greenhouse gas emissions by approximately 20%,” the company said. 

“At the same time, ammonia can serve as a carbon-free fuel by utilising converted LNG storage facilities, while offering relatively lower conversion costs and comparatively well-developed supply chains and infrastructure. The Ammonia Fuel Ready design will therefore provide Yang Ming with greater flexibility in responding to increasingly stringent international regulations on greenhouse gas emissions.”

In addition, the vessels will be equipped with Type B LNG fuel tanks with a design pressure of 1.0 bar to enhance the safety and efficiency of LNG operations, together with a range of energy-saving technologies, including Wind Shields, Rudder Bulbs, Pre-Swirl Stators, and Shore Power Systems. Smart ship technologies and cybersecurity protection features will also be incorporated to enhance operational efficiency, safety, and reliability while effectively reducing fuel consumption and greenhouse gas emissions.

Deliveries under Yang Ming’s next-generation fleet optimization plan commenced earlier this year. By 2030, a total of 24 new vessels are expected to enter service. 

This includes 18 LNG dual-fuel vessels—comprising five 15,500 TEU, seven 16,000 TEU, and the six 13,000 TEU vessels under this contract—alongside six 8,000 TEU methanol dual-fuel-ready ships.

LR, China’s MARIC unveil tanker concept ready for three future bunker fuels

Lloyd’s Register (LR) and the Marine Design and Research Institute of China (MARIC) on Thursday (3 September) have secured Approval in Principle (AiP) for a new 114,000 DWT product and crude oil tanker designed to accommodate future conversion to LNG, methanol or ammonia.

Announced at SMM 2026, the concept addresses one of the biggest investment challenges facing shipping today: the need to develop vessels and capabilities that can support a range of alternative fuel options and pathways as technologies, infrastructure and regulations evolve.

While LNG is already a mature fuel pathway, methanol and ammonia remain at an earlier stage of development, with questions around global fuel availability, infrastructure development, economics and long-term adoption.

The 114,000 DWT tanker concept has been designed as a product and crude oil carrier that can accommodate future conversion to LNG, methanol or ammonia as technologies, regulations and fuel supply chains mature. By incorporating conversion readiness at the design stage, the concept aims to reduce future retrofit complexity and provide owners with greater confidence when planning long-term fleet investments.

The design concept was reviewed against LR’s July 2026 class rules and regulations, including requirements relating to ships using gases and other low-flashpoint fuels, alongside relevant IACS Common Structural Rules for oil tankers. Final classification and statutory approval remain subject to full compliance with all applicable rules and regulations.

Theo Kourmpelis, Global Business Director for Tankers, Lloyd’s Register, said: “Shipowners are being asked to make major investment decisions today despite continued uncertainty around which fuels will dominate in the decades ahead. Alternative fuel solutions each offer potential pathways to compliance, but fuel infrastructure, regulation and economics continue to evolve at different speeds around the world.

“Designs that preserve flexibility will be critical in helping owners manage risk while preparing for multiple future scenarios.”

Si Nan, Marine & Offshore Marketing Department Vice Director, MARIC, said: “As the industry explores different decarbonisation pathways, shipowners need vessel designs that can adapt alongside technological and regulatory developments. This concept was developed specifically to provide greater fuel flexibility and long-term resilience, allowing owners to respond to changing market requirements without being locked into a single fuel strategy.

“Receiving Approval in Principle from Lloyd’s Register is an important milestone that validates the design concept and supports its future development.”

DNV: Alternative-fuelled vessel orders hit highest monthly level since October 2024

Latest data from classification society DNV’s Alternative Fuels Insight (AFI) platform alternative-fuelled vessel ordering was strong in August, with 52 new vessels added to the platform.

This is the highest monthly total since October 2024 and follows another active month in July, when 47 vessels were added to the database.

LNG-fuelled vessels accounted for the vast majority of August activity, with 46 orders recorded. The container segment led the way with 30 orders, while the car carrier segment contributed a further 12 LNG-fuelled vessels. In addition, four ethanol-fuelled bulk carriers and two hydrogen-powered bulk carriers were added during the month, as well as one LNG bunker vessel.

The strong summer performance marked a significant acceleration in ordering activity after a relatively slow start to the year. In total, 242 alternative-fuelled vessel orders have been placed in the first eight months of 2026, representing a 27% increase compared with the same period in 2025.

LNG remains the dominant fuel choice, accounting for 63% of all alternative-fuelled vessel orders registered so far this year. Container vessels represent the largest share of these LNG orders (59%), followed by car carriers (30%).

Jason Stefanatos, Global Decarbonization Director at DNV Maritime, said: “The past two months have been particularly strong for alternative-fuelled vessel ordering, with August recording the highest monthly total we’ve seen since October 2024. This has helped lift year-to-date orders to a level well above the same period last year.

“LNG remains the leading fuel choice, driven largely by activity in the container and car carrier segments. These sectors have been among the earliest adopters of alternative fuels, supported by predictable liner operations and increasing demand from cargo owners to reduce emissions across supply chains. 

“For many owners, LNG offers a combination of emissions reductions, fuel availability and future flexibility while the longer-term fuel landscape continues to evolve. 

“At the same time, the latest figures include orders for ethanol- and hydrogen-fuelled vessels, highlighting that owners continue to explore a range of decarbonization pathways. Different segments are making different fuel choices, but the overall level of activity demonstrates continued investment in lower-emission shipping.”
